Michael: Teenagers have their own vocabulary. Here are some slang words used in school. |
SLANG EXPRESSIONS |
Michael: The expressions you will be learning in this lesson are: |
Anna: șase |
Anna: lebădă |
Anna: boboc |
Anna: tufă de Veneția |
Michael: Anna, what's our first expression? |
Anna: șase |
Michael: literally meaning "six-six." But, when it's used as a slang expression, it means "attention, keep watch." |
Anna: [SLOW] șase [NORMAL] șase |
Michael: Listeners, please repeat. |
Anna: șase |
[pause - 5 sec.] |
Michael: Use this slang expression when you want to make someone be attentive, as a warning of upcoming danger, keep watch. |
Michael: Now let's hear an example sentence. |
Anna: [NORMAL] Șase-șase! Vine profa! [SLOW] Șase-șase! Vine profa! |
Michael: "Attention! The teacher is coming!" |
Anna: [NORMAL] Șase-șase! Vine profa! |
Michael: Okay, what's the next expression? |
Anna: lebădă |
Michael: literally meaning "swan." But, when it's used as a slang expression, it means "the number two." |
Anna: [SLOW] lebădă [NORMAL] lebădă |
Michael: Listeners, please repeat. |
Anna: lebădă |
[pause - 5 sec.] |
Michael: Use this slang expression when you refer to the written number two, that looks like a swan. |
Michael: Now let's hear an example sentence. |
Anna: [NORMAL] Cât ai luat la Mate? O lebădă? [SLOW] Cât ai luat la Mate? O lebădă? |
Michael: "What grade did you get in Math? A two?" |
Anna: [NORMAL] Cât ai luat la Mate? O lebădă? |
Michael: Okay, what's our next expression? |
Anna: boboc |
Michael: literally meaning "bud." But, when it's used as a slang expression, it means "freshman." |
Anna: [SLOW] boboc [NORMAL] boboc |
Michael: Listeners, please repeat. |
Anna: boboc |
[pause - 5 sec.] |
Michael: Use this slang expression when you refer to a first year student. |
Michael: Now let's hear an example sentence. |
Anna: [NORMAL] Uită-te la bobocii ăia ce timizi sunt! [SLOW] Uită-te la bobocii ăia ce timizi sunt! |
Michael: "Look at how shy those freshmen are!" |
Anna: [NORMAL] Uită-te la bobocii ăia ce timizi sunt! |
Michael: Okay, what's the last expression? |
Anna: tufă de Veneția |
Michael: literally meaning "Venice bush." But, when it's used as a slang expression, it means "ignorant." |
Anna: [SLOW] tufă de Veneția [NORMAL] tufă de Veneția |
Michael: Listeners, please repeat. |
Anna: tufă de Veneția |
[pause - 5 sec.] |
Michael: Use this slang expression when you refer to someone who doesn't know anything. It's known that Venice is full of water so bushes don't grow there. |
Michael: Now let's hear an example sentence. |
Anna: [NORMAL] Astăzi am fost tufă de Veneția la Română. [SLOW] Astăzi am fost tufă de Veneția la Română. |
Michael: "I was completely ignorant at Romanian today." |
Anna: [NORMAL] Astăzi am fost tufă de Veneția la Română. |
